what is a subscript used for in a chemical formula?
A subscript is usually next to an element in a compound and basically tells you how many atoms that element has in the chemical formula. For example, If the formula is CO2, there is one carbon atom and two oxygen atoms.

What is a coefficient?
The coefficient is used to tell you how many atoms of each element there are for the whole chemical formula. For example, in 2NaCl there are two sodium and two chlorine atoms so you have a total of 4 atoms.

What happens if a coefficient and a subscript are in the same formula, like 4CaCl2?
What happens is that you multiply the two numbers to tell you how many atoms the element that is next to the subscript has. In this case, Calcium has 4 atoms, and since 4 times 2 equals 8, chlorine has 8 atoms for a total of 12 atoms.
